Evening train service will run as scheduled, Railways General Manger Vijaya Amaratunga said today. This was after a sudden strike by the engine drivers was called off.
Mr Amarathunga said that the trade unions took trade union action after an engine driver was attacked by commuters as he was sleeping in the drivers cabin.
He claimed that the public had suspected the driver was drunk and beaten the driver yet the driver had slept since he was not well. He explained that a driver had high sugar as well as pressure at the time and rested.
He said that the public must not get into hasty decisions and assault drivers who are working despite of ailments.
